Abstract
The utility model provides an intelligent salinity meter which comprises a detection head, a high definition camera, a video line, a computer, a control line, an alarm device and an intelligent fresh water control box, wherein the detection head is fixedly connected with the high definition camera; the high definition camera is electrically connected with the computer through the video line; the computer is electrically connected with the alarm device through the control line; and the computer is electrically connected with the intelligent fresh water control box through the control line. The intelligent salinity meter has the beneficial effects that the reading is conveniently observed, the salinity of the water can be automatically detected, an alarm is automatically given, and the salinity of the water is automatically regulated.

Background technology
Salinometer is to design for the concentration of measuring salt solusion, saliferous food and seawater, salt solution.Distinctive two rule scale marks can directly read proportion and the concentration of solution.The concentration management of the salt solution that the seawater that can be applicable to ocean, fishing ground, plant to use, the seawater that use in the aquarium or artificial seawater, storage fish are used etc.Be very helpful for agricultural, food making and field work tool, it is especially desirable to field work to have increased the temperature self-compensation system.Because light can produce refraction effect when a kind of medium enters another kind of medium, and the ratio of incident angle sine perseverance is definite value, and this ratio is called index of refraction.Utilize in the salt solusion solable matter content and index of refraction in direct ratio under conventional environment, can determine the index of refraction of salt solusion, thereby ask the concentration of calculating salt, can read salt concentration or sea water specific gravity rapidly.
But also there are many defectives in this salinometer, and eye could be observed concentration content near eyepiece during use, the people who has defective vision is used just inconvenience, and misunderstand reading easily; Will arrive on-site sampling during measurement, it is consuming time to consume the worker like this, increases cost of labor; And existing product does not have warning function, can not control the salinity of water automatically, the cost of labor height.

Embodiment
Below in conjunction with the accompanying drawing among the utility model embodiment, the technical scheme among the utility model embodiment is clearly and completely described, obviously, described embodiment only is the utility model part embodiment, rather than whole embodiment.Based on the embodiment in the utility model, those of ordinary skills are not making the every other embodiment that obtains under the creative work prerequisite, all belong to the scope of the utility model protection.
With reference to Fig. 1, intelligent salinometer comprises detection head 1, high-definition camera 2, video line 3, computer 4, control line 5, warning device 7, intelligent fresh water control box (not shown); Described detection head 1 is fixedlyed connected with described high-definition camera 2, described high-definition camera 2 electrically connects by described video line 3 and described computer 4, described computer 4 electrically connects by described control line 5 and described warning device 7, and described computer 4 electrically connects by described control line 5 and described intelligent fresh water control box.
Further, described intelligent fresh water control box also comprises shell 61, fresh water import 62, water outlet 63, salt water inlet 64, brine outlet 65, fresh water solenoid valve 66, salt water solenoid valve 67 and control panel 68.Fresh water enters from described fresh water import 62 again and flows out from described water outlet 63, by the outflow of described fresh water solenoid valve 66 control fresh water; Salt solution enters from described salt water inlet 64 again and flows out from described brine outlet 65, by the outflow of described salt water solenoid valve 67 control salt solution; The switch of described fresh water solenoid valve 66 and described salt water solenoid valve 67 is by described control panel 68 controls.
Further, described fresh water import 62, described water outlet 63, described salt water inlet 64 and described brine outlet 65 are fixed on the described shell 61, described fresh water solenoid valve 66 and described salt water solenoid valve 67 are arranged on described shell 61 inside, described fresh water import 62 is fixedlyed connected with described water outlet 63 by described fresh water solenoid valve 66, described salt water inlet 64 is fixedlyed connected with described brine outlet 65 by described salt water solenoid valve 67, described fresh water solenoid valve 66, described salt water solenoid valve 67 and described control line 5 all electrically connect with described control panel 68, and described control panel 68 is fixed on intelligent fresh water control box inside.
Further, described detection head 1 appearance is provided with corrosion-resistant coating (not shown).Arranging of corrosion-resistant coating can prevent detection head by brine corrosion, increases the serviceable life of detection head.
Further, described intelligent fresh water control box is provided with manual fresh water key (not shown) and manual salt solution key (not shown).Manually fresh water key and when manually the salt solution key is used for emergency or equipment and breaks down carries out manual operations.
